API Report for MDM (Configuration) Services

The API details for managing the configuration activities on the tenant.

Table 1. Reltio MDM Services - Config API Mapping
Resource ID HTTP Method Rest URI Privileges
UN_SECURED_BY_ANNOTATION

GET

GET

GET

GET

GET

GET

GET

GET

GET

GET

HEAD

HEAD

HEAD

/eventsHubHealth

/health

/healthcheck

/status

/status/rdm

/status/tenant/{tenantId}

/version

/version/matching

/version/sdk

/version/server

/eventsHubHealth

/health

/healthcheck

 
config.businessModel

DELETE

DELETE

GET

GET

GET

GET

GET

GET

GET

GET

GET

GET

GET

GET

GET

GET

GET

GET

GET

GET

GET

POST

POST

POST

POST

PUT

/api//generators/{name}

/configuration/sources/{sourceType}

/api//generators

/api//generators/{name}

/api//generators/{name}/generate

/configuration

/configuration/_history

/configuration/_history/_noInheritance

/configuration/_noInheritance

/configuration/attributeTypes

/configuration/entityTypes

/configuration/entityTypes/{entityTypeName}/matchGroups

/configuration/entityTypes/{entityType}/_template

/configuration/graphTypes

/configuration/groupTypes

/configuration/interactionTypes

/configuration/noiseDictionaries

/configuration/noiseDictionaries/{dictionaryName}

/configuration/relationTypes

/configuration/roles

/configuration/sources

/api//generators

/configuration/_comparison

/configuration/_validation

/configuration/sources

/configuration

-

-

-

-

-

-

-

-

-

-

-

-

-

-

-

-

-

-

-

-

-

-

READ

READ

-

-

config.businessModel.source

GET

PUT

/configuration/sources/{sourceTypeName}/sourcePublishDate

/configuration/sources/{sourceTypeName}/sourcePublishDate

-

UPDATE

config.businessModel.survivorship

POST

POST

PUT

PUT

/configuration/entityTypes/{entityTypeName}/survivorshipGroups

/configuration/relationTypes/{relationshipTypeName}/survivorshipGroups

/configuration/entityTypes/{entityTypeName}/survivorshipGroups/{groupUri}

/configuration/relationTypes/{relationshipTypeName}/survivorshipGroups/{groupUri}

 
config.businessModel.warn POST /configuration/_setIgnoreWarnings UPDATE
config.businessModel.activity

GET

PUT

/activityConfiguration

/activityConfiguration

 
config.businessModel.rating

GET

PUT

PUT

/ratingConfiguration

/ratingConfiguration/sources

/ratingConfiguration/userRoles

 
config.businessModel.ruleset

GET

GET

PUT

PUT

PUT

/rulesetsConfiguration

/rulesetsConfiguration/currentRulesets

/rulesetsConfiguration

/rulesetsConfiguration/entityTypes/{entityTypeName}/survivorshipGroups

/rulesetsConfiguration/entityTypes/{entityTypeName}/survivorshipGroups/{groupUri}

 
config.endpoint

DELETE

GET

POST

POST

POST

/access/{tenantId}

/access/{tenantId}

/access/{tenantId}

/access/{tenantId}/_check

/access/{tenantId}/_get

-

-

-

READ

READ

config.lookups

DELETE

GET

GET

POST

POST

POST

POST

POST

POST

PUT

/lookups

/lookups

/lookups/{code}/{codeValue}

/lookups

/lookups/cascadeUpdate

/lookups/list

/lookups/resolve

/lookups/resolveList

/lookups/validate

/lookups

-

-

-

-

UPDATE

READ

READ

READ

READ

-

config.permissions

DELETE

GET

POST

POST

POST

POST

POST

/permissions/{tenantId}

/permissions/{tenantId}

/permissions/{tenantId}

/permissions/{tenantId}/_check

/permissions/{tenantId}/_checkOption

/permissions/{tenantId}/_get

/permissions/{tenantId}/_getAccessRoles

-

-

-

READ

READ

READ

READ

config.physical

GET

GET

GET

GET

GET

GET

GET

GET

GET

GET

POST

POST

PUT

PUT

PUT

PUT

/enhancedTenants

/tenants/{tenantId}

/tenants/{tenantId}/_history

/tenants/{tenantId}/_validateTenantConfiguration

/tenants/{tenantId}/cleanse

/tenants/{tenantId}/dataloadMode

/tenants/{tenantId}/messaging

/tenants/{tenantId}/name

/tenants/{tenantId}/rdmTenants

/tenants/{tenantId}/validateTenantConfiguration

/tenants/{tenantId}/messaging/destinations

/tenants/{tenantId}/messaging/destinations/_packRemove

/tenants/{tenantId}/cleanse

/tenants/{tenantId}/dataloadMode

/tenants/{tenantId}/name

/tenants/{tenantId}/rdmTenants

-

-

-

-

-

-

-

-

UPDATE

-

-

-

-

-

-

-

config.preference GET /personal/allSavedSearches  
config.resources

DELETE

GET

GET

POST

/{tenantId}/resources/i18n

/{tenantId}/resources/i18n

/{tenantId}/resources/i18n/languages

/{tenantId}/resources/i18n